ERECTION AND COMMISSIONING <br />4.1 Upon delivery of the Plant components at the Mine, Seller shall work with Buyer and <br />Buyer's contractor to erect and commission the Plant. Seller estimates 45-60 days for the <br />erection and commissioning work. <br />4.2 As part of the erection and commissioning work, Seller agrees to: <br />a. Provide direction and oversight to Buyer's contractors during erection of the Plant; <br />b. Provide training to Buyer's personnel on operation of the Plant during commissioning <br />and until such time as they can confidently operate the Plant. Specifically, Seller or <br />Seller's affiliated company agrees to provide One (1) or two (2) qualified and trained <br />technicians, at Seller's expense, to provide technical assistance for the erection and <br />commissioning. Such technicians shall be provided for no less than forty-five (45) days <br />and in all cases until at least the Operational Date; <br />c. Provide certain spare parts with delivery of the Plant should such parts be needed <br />during erection and commissioning; and <br />d. Comply with Buyer's policies and all MSHA and OSHA regulations while at the <br />Mine. <br />4.3 As part of the erection and commissioning, Buyer agrees to: <br />a. Provide a concrete pad to Seller's specifications, as outlined in Attachment E hereto <br />(at a location selected by Buyer); <br />b. Provide adequate power to the erection and commissioning site; <br />c. Provide a qualified mechanical contractor that employs at least 3 to 4 welders and 2 to <br />3 Iaborers to assist Seller in erecting the Plant. Seller estimates that the crew would be <br />needed for up to six (6) weeks; <br />3 <br />
